Responsibilities:
- Design, develop and optimize SceneGen framework to fully automatically generate hybrid or synthetic scenarios
- Scale up SceneGen to generate high quality scenarios in large scale simulation
- Integrate AI/ML models in SceneGen framework to increase realism of generated scenarios
- Define quality and realism metrics and implement methodologies to evaluate the quality/realism of generated scenarios
- Integrate SceneGen in cloud simulation and hardware-in-loop simulation platforms
- Collaborate with Eval teams to create SceneGen based eval workflows for targeted onboard problem clusters
